stand off

Stand-off in Vancleave

Jackson County Sheriff’s Department was in a standoff this morning with a man who barricaded himself inside his home in Vancleave. News 25’s Gabby Easterwood has more.

Hostage Situation and Standoff in Jackson

A hostage situation is going on at a rooming house in Jackson. It all started this morning. Police say 13 hostages have been released and at least one more person is still barricaded inside a home. A 9-1-1 call came…